“What Will Michael Jordan Think?”: When Magic Johnson Wondered How Larry Bird and MJ Would React to His HIV Diagnosis
Magic Johnson is an NBA legend. His legacy is one for history. A 6ft 9″ point guard, Johnson was a miracle that propelled the NBA to fame. His rivalry with Larry Bird and their endless battles for supremacy paved the path for what the sport is today.
Apart from Larry, whom Magic Johnson considered a close friend and rival, the Laker legend also maintained close contact with Michael Jordan. In a way, Jordan brought the end of Larry and Magic’s era.
Somewhere, Magic was even envious of all Michael had achieved. Yet, when Magic Johnson came to know of his life-changing diagnosis, he chose to inform MJ and Larry Bird before others. However, he was still concerned with the outcome.
Magic Johnson was afraid of Larry Bird and Michael Jordan’s reaction
In 1991, right before the new season was to start, Magic was diagnosed with HIV. Upon coming to know, one of his first instructions was to inform Michael Jordan and Larry Bird about it. He wanted them to know what was going on. In case, if the press reached out to them, they’d be well prepared.
However, despite his decision, Johnson couldn’t help but wonder how MJ and Bird would react to the news. In his book ‘When the Game was Ours,’ Johnson detailed the instance in detail.
“As he ticked off the names, Magic paused to consider how each of them would react. They would be stunned, he was certain. Would they also be disappointed? Disgusted? Would it change the level of respect he enjoyed with each of them? “You don’t have a lot of time to think about it, because everything is happening so fast,” Magic said. “But at some point I was wondering, ‘What will Larry think? What will Michael think?'”
Magic played in the Dream Team months after his HIV diagnosis
The Dream Team was formed in 1992 and competed in the Barcelona Olympics. They were exceptional and easily bested all opponents in the tournament.
In fact, the 1992 Dream Team is widely considered to be the greatest team in history. Fortunately, the team gave Johnson the opportunity to join the squad even after the diagnosis.
